Subject syllabus

1. Implementing an algorithm on a computer.
2. How a computer works -- the principle of a digital computer.
3. Personal computer hardware.
4. Personal computer software.
5. Operating Systems - MS DOS.
6. Operating Systems - MS Windows.
7. Local and remote computer networks. The Internet and its services, the World Wide Web.
8. Writing and processing texts in MS Word text editor – basic controls, working with files.
9. MS Word – working with blocks, formats.
10. MS Word – working with styles, tables, etc.
11. Creating tables and charts in MS Excel.
12. MS Excel - basic controls, writing data, formulas, working with files.
13. MS Excel– editing a table, working with blocks, formats.
14. MS Excel– Table Appearance, Charting.
